About the Service

Monmouth Domiciliary Care commissioned by Monmouthshire council, offers consistent, person-centred support to one young person with a disability, helping them build independence, manage daily routines, and feel confident in their home environment.

A bit about the role

As a Housing Support Worker, your support will be tailored entirely to their needs, goals, and personality.

We're looking for someone who is patient, positive, and genuinely caring - to provide dedicated one to one support for the young person who is living in their own home. If you're the kind of person who finds purpose in helping others grow, thrive, and feel secure, this role could be a perfect fit.

What you do could make a difference
  • Providing one to one support within the young person's home including personal care tasks such as hygiene routines, dressing, or mobility assistance
  • Encouraging independence with daily living skills
  • Some light cleaning duties around the home
  • Supporting with routines, appointments, and community activities
  • Helping maintain a safe, comfortable, and positive home environment
  • Promoting confidence, wellbeing, and social inclusion
  • Working collaboratively with family members and professionals
  • Keeping clear, accurate notes to ensure consistent, high-quality care
Let's talk about you
  • Level 3 qualification in Health and Social (or equivalent) of working towards
  • Previous experience supporting children, young people, or adults with disabilities
  • Experience working in domiciliary care, supported living, education, youth work, or a similar setting
  • Experience supporting individuals with daily living skills (routines, organisation, community access)
  • Experience following care plans, risk assessments, and safeguarding procedures
  • An ability to build positive, trusting relationships with individuals who may need reassurance or structure
  • Experience working as part of a multi-agency team (desirable)
